-
“Pesco” Hand Painted Canvas
Regular price From £149.00 GBPRegular priceUnit price perSale price From £149.00 GBP -
“Inception” Hand Painted Canvas
Regular price From £149.00 GBPRegular priceUnit price perSale price From £149.00 GBP -
“Wonders” Hand Painted Canvas
Regular price From £179.00 GBPRegular priceUnit price perSale price From £179.00 GBP -
“Petals” Hand Painted Canvas
Regular price From £179.00 GBPRegular priceUnit price perSale price From £179.00 GBP -
“Pearls” Hand Painted Canvas
Regular price From £149.00 GBPRegular priceUnit price perSale price From £149.00 GBP -
“Harmony” Hand Painted Canvas
Regular price From £179.00 GBPRegular priceUnit price perSale price From £179.00 GBP -
“Family” Hand Painted Canvas
Regular price From £149.00 GBPRegular priceUnit price perSale price From £149.00 GBP -
“Brooke” Hand Painted Canvas
Regular price From £179.00 GBPRegular priceUnit price perSale price From £179.00 GBP -
“Hale” Hand Painted Canvas
Regular price From £149.00 GBPRegular priceUnit price perSale price From £149.00 GBP -
“Starburst” Hand Painted Canvas
Regular price From £149.00 GBPRegular priceUnit price per£199.00 GBPSale price From £149.00 GBPSale -
“Chaos” Hand Painted Canvas
Regular price From £179.00 GBPRegular priceUnit price perSale price From £179.00 GBP -
“Storm” Hand Painted Canvas Set
Regular price From £149.00 GBPRegular priceUnit price perSale price From £149.00 GBP -
“Dune” Hand Painted Canvas Set
Regular price From £199.00 GBPRegular priceUnit price perSale price From £199.00 GBP -
“Malibu” Hand Painted Canvas
Regular price From £179.00 GBPRegular priceUnit price perSale price From £179.00 GBP -
“Solar” Hand Painted Canvas
Regular price From £179.00 GBPRegular priceUnit price perSale price From £179.00 GBP -
“Love” Hand Painted Canvas
Regular price From £179.00 GBPRegular priceUnit price perSale price From £179.00 GBP















